  • AEC-Q200 qualified
  • High power up to 1W
  • Tolerance down to 0.1%
  • TCR down to 15ppm/°C
  • High pulse handling capability All parts are Pb-free and comply with EU Directive 2011/65/EU amended by (EU) 2015/863 (RoHS3) Physical Data Construction A metal film is deposited onto a high dissipation ceramic former to which tin plated terminating caps are fitted. The resistor is adjusted to value by a helical cut in the film and the body is protected by a lacquer coating. Marking Resistance values are colour coded with three or four bands, indicating value and multiplier. Terminations Material Plated steel cap Solderability The pure tin finish produces ageing free contacts on which low melting solders can be used. Dipped area shall be covered with a smooth and bright solder coating after 3 seconds immersion at 215°C. Solvent Resistance The body protection and marking are resistant to all normal industrial cleaning solvents suitable for printed circuit boards.

All information is subject to TT Electronics’ own data and is considered accurate at time of going to print. © TT Electronics plc BI Technologies IRC Welwyn www.ttelectronics.com/resistors 01.25 Pulse & Surge Performance Single Pulse 50 rectangular pulses applied at 60s intervals such that mean power is less than 10% of rated power. Maximum permitted change is ±1%. Continuous Pulses Continuous rectangular pulses applied at intervals such that mean power is equal to the rated power. Maximum permitted change is ±1%. 1.2/50µs Lightning Surge IEC 60115-1 1.2/50µs surge test, 10 surges. Maximum permitted change is ±0.5%. 10/700µs Lightning Surge IEC 60115-1 10/700µs surge test, 10 surges. Maximum permitted change is ±0.5%. Ordering Procedure Example: WRM0204HPC-2K49FT3 (WRM0204HP, 50ppm/°C, 2.49 kilohms ±1%, Pb-free) Packaging WRM0204HP resistors are supplied in 8mm plastic tape on 7” reels. WRM0207HP resistors are supplied in 12mm plastic tape on 7” reels. Packing complies with the requirements of IEC286-3.
